Published on July 4, 2020, Brenda Wanga, wife of a Kenyan footballer, has shared her message of hope after being laid off from NTV, along with several others.

Wanga, who was laid off alongside Ken Mijungu, Debarl Inea, and Harith Salim, penned a powerful message, saying, 'When you become a statistic! We shall rise from these ashes, like the phoenix.'

Her words echo the sentiments of Ken Mijungu, who took to social media to announce his layoff, saying, 'The axe fell at NTV's newsroom and I was on its way. 7 years in those corridors summed up in a two-page letter of termination. We live to fight another day. Thanks to God, He remains the greatest, thank you NTV for the opportunity and thank you for always staying tuned.'

Wanga's message is a testament to the resilience of those who have been laid off, including those who lost their jobs at Media Max in June 2020. As one door closes, another opens, and it is hoped that they will be able to pick up the pieces and move on.
